Beudy'r Wennol is a luxurious and beautifully renovated barn conversion in Groeslon, Gwynedd, Wales. The property sleeps 6 people in 3 bedrooms and features a hot tub and is located near a pub. The barn conversion retains original features while incorporating modern facilities like underfloor heating, contemporary furnishings, and oak doors. The spacious sitting room has a stunning exposed stone wall, high pitched ceiling, woodburner, and comfy leather sofas, providing a relaxing space after a day of activities.
The well-equipped kitchen with a Rangemaster stove is a social space for family dining. The three bedrooms all have hand-crafted oak king-size beds, patio doors, and one has an en-suite shower room. An additional bathroom and cloakroom are available for convenience. The attached outbuilding provides storage space for bikes and equipment, as well as entertainment with a pool table and dart board. The front courtyard and decked seating area offer a shared space with Plas Mawr, while the private garden at the rear provides a peaceful retreat.
Situated in a tranquil setting surrounded by farmland near Groeslon village, Beudy'r Wennol is close to Caernarfon and offers excellent walking routes and access to the Blue Flag beach at Dinas Dinlle. Snowdon and attractions like Bounce Below and Zip World Velocity 2 are within easy reach. This retreat is perfect for a relaxing getaway with activities for all seasons. Note: Beudy'r Wennol can be booked alongside Ref 974514 to accommodate larger groups of up to 14 people.
